Garden Flooring with Composite Decking
To improve your yard and create room for your hobbies, you’ll need appropriate flooring. Composite is one material that may be used to lay a yard floor. This type of outdoor flooring is said to be the best for garden decks. Consider the following characteristics to see why wood-plastic composite is the best option for your outdoor flooring.
Your garden will benefit from Composite Decking.
When you install composite decking in your garden, you will receive what you pay for. This is due to the fact that wood plastic composite decking is cost-effective. When you build your deck with composite, you can be confident that it will last a long time. Gardeners who need to install wood-plastic composite have been doing it for over two decades. Some wood-plastic decking products are more durable than others, lasting up to 30 years. Let’s compare the benefits of a longer-lasting wood plastic composite decking to the benefits of a longer-lasting wood deck. Wood decking has a 10- to 15-year life expectancy. It means you’ll have to repair the decaying wood decking after 15 years. Garden owners will pay extra for this process of replacing wood decking. Composite does not require replacing until after 30 years of use. Gardeners will be able to save money as a result of this.

Easy to maintain
You build decking in your garden with the intention of using it every day. The surface will become soiled as you use your decks. If you have children, they can mess up your wood plastic composite decking by playing on it. Your feet might also track mud or dust onto your decking as you walk on it. When this happens, cleaning your decking is necessary to restore its appearance. However, the type of deck you install will determine how you clean it. Cleaning wood-plastic composite decking is simple. In reality, composite decking is one of the most easy-to-clean outdoor flooring options. All gardeners need is a cloth or broom, and a brush if the decking surface is covered with obstinate dirt. During maintenance, there is no need to sand, stain, or seal the wood-plastic composite decking surface. This demonstrates that composite decking is one of the best garden decking materials.
